You can usually move (or copy) IL-2 from one folder to another ok (this allows multiple installs too). You'll need to create a new desktop shortcut for the moved .exe, but otherwise it should run as is.

Some programs and games are dependent on registry settings and they fail if moved to another location. The IL2 series are not among those, you can even have multiple Windows installed and run this sim from the same folder while in XP, Vista or Win7.
That's the beauty of programs which have ALL of their configuration files in their own folder, instead of the other philosophy: user and configuration files somewhere in "My Documents" or even worse, inside an obscure folder named "Application Data".
